Karoline Leavitt Insists Trump Needs Filibuster Abolished to Deal With ‘Crazed’ Democrats

 

White House Press Secretary Karoline Leavitt fully supported President Donald Trump’s call to abolish the filibuster during an appearance on Fox News on Sunday morning, saying it was necessary to avoid future government shutdowns and the need to deal with Democratic lawmakers, who she said are “crazed people.”

Leavitt shared her thoughts on the matter during an interview with Maria Bartiromo on Sunday Morning Futures. Bartiromo, in her first question, asked Leavitt if the president had talked to Senate Majority Leader John Thune (R-SD), after a rep for Thune said he is not in favor of getting rid of the filibuster.

The press secretary said Trump had spoken to Thune and House Speaker Mike Johnson (R-LA) about his idea, before adding he is “100% right” about it.

“Let’s talk about what we are dealing with here — radical-left democrats who have shut our government down and held the American people hostage for 32 days in a row,” Leavitt started off by saying.

She then ran through a laundry list of issues piling up because of the shutdown, including SNAP benefits going unpaid and air traffic controller shortages. Leavitt said these issues are all due to the Dems being unwilling to cut a deal and reopen the government — which is why ditching the filibuster is necessary, she said.

“Democrats are not showing any sign of wanting to reopen the government. They want to give taxpayer funded benefits to illegal aliens. These are crazed people that President Trump and republicans are having to deal with,” Leavitt said. “And that’s why President Trump has said Republicans need to get tough, they need to get smart, and they need to use this option to get rid of the filibuster to reopen the government and do right by the American public.”

She added that polling and “common sense” show that most Americans want the shutdown to end and would support it.

Her comment comes a day after the president, for the second time since Thursday, urged Republicans to not be “WEAK AND STUPID” and to “TERMINATE” the filibuster.
